Friends of the Dane County Farmers’ Market
What is Friends of the DCFM?
Friends of the Dane County Farmers’ Market is a non-profit organization founded in April 2003 to support the educational and outreach activities of the Dane County Farmers’ Market.
Activities of Friends of the DCFM
Friends of DCFM has a year-round presence at the Farmers' Market.
Spring
and Summer:
| |
• School on the Square.  Friends of the DCFM volunteers work with the UW Dietetics and Nutrition Club and market vendors to sponsor food and market products related
programs for children and adults. Activities range from transplanting seedlings to making musical
instruments with gourds, making edible jewelry from baby veggies and taking a sunflower quiz.
• Children’s Activities.  Friends of the DCFM organize educational and entertaining events at the Market relating to where food comes from. Planting, tasting, learning about seeds, and growing are all part of the fun.
• Adult Activities.  Friends of the DCFM works with community organizations and market vendors to demonstrate and provide information and recipes on subjects such as over-wintering rosemary plants, composting, using the different parts of sunflower plants and making herb flavored vinegars.
• Food Tastings.  Friends of the DCFM works with Madison Herb Society, market vendors and area chefs to provide free samples and recipes featuring DCFM vendor products.
•
Farm
Fresh Atlas.  Working with REAP
Food Group, Center
for Integrated Agriculture, and the Dane County Farmers’
Market, Friends of the DCFM works to provide this free
guide listing farms and food-related businesses that sell
their goods directly to customers in southern Wisconsin.
Friends' volunteers distribute the Atlas at the early
spring outdoor markets on the Square. The Atlas is available
at the DCFM Information Booth until the supply runs out
and at any of the locations listed here.
•
FoodShare.  For the second year, Friends of
the DCFM is working with volunteers to allow families
and individuals to buy edible Farmers' Market products
with their Quest cards or "food stamps". Friends of the
DCFM volunteers set up every Saturday at the DCFM information
booth at the State St corner of the Capitol Square from
7am to 1pm to assist FoodShare participants. FoodShare
is also available at the Wednesday Farmers' Market, located
on MLK Blvd, from 9am to 1pm at the Pecatonica Valley
Farm stand.

Autumn
and Winter:
| |
•FoodShare.
Friends of the DCFM work with volunteers
at the Monona Terrace and the Senior Center to provide
FoodShare participants an opportunity to shop at the Winter
Markets. Friends of the DCFM volunteers are located at
the DCFM information booth to assist participants.
School on the Square at Monona Terrace.  Friends
of the DCFM works with market vendors to spotlight winter
market products with information, food tastings and recipes.
• Food Donations.  Friends of the DCFM works with the Community Action Coalition to sponsor a Food Drive between Thanksgiving and Christmas. This is an exceptional opportunity to supply local food pantries with fresh market produce during the winter months.

“Friends” Mission
The mission of Friends of the Dane County Farmers’ Market is to:
| |
• Encourage children and adults to think about how the food they eat gets to their fork.
• Increase the community's nutrition and food-preparation knowledge by demonstrating techniques, providing recipes and giving out information about the benefits of consuming locally produced fruits, vegetables, herbs, meats, cheeses, fish and
bakery.
• Provide opportunities for food from the market to be donated to food pantries, charities and those in need. Provide opportunities for everyone in the community to be a part of the sustainable, local food movement.
